Output 3150015375181c9eb7e6702c69c80b49df2715c6a801f61c303b4bf47d12a89a:2

value
89523
script pubkey
OP_0 OP_PUSHBYTES_20 e783397202bb767ce021928bbaf24d86394b8c78
address
bc1qu7pnjuszhdm8ecppj29m4ujdscu5hrrczqc0cd
transaction
3150015375181c9eb7e6702c69c80b49df2715c6a801f61c303b4bf47d12a89a
spent
true